Copper Mountain Technologies Expands U.S. Production, Strengthening Indiana’s Advanced Manufacturing Sector

INDIANAPOLIS, March 13,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Copper Mountain Technologies (CMT), a leader in radio frequency (RF) test and measurement solutions, has successfully transitioned its manufacturing operations to Indiana, reinforcing its commitment to domestic production and supply chain reliability.

The company’s decision to move production from overseas was driven by a need for greater flexibility, improved lead times, and more streamlined logistics. For years, the company had depended on manufacturing partners overseas for the production of its vector network analyzers (VNAs). However, with increasing global supply chain disruptions caused by the COVID-19 pandemic, geopolitical instability, and unpredictable shipping delays, it was evident that a new strategy was needed.

Copper Mountain Technologies decided that bringing manufacturing closer to home would not only provide better control over production timelines and quality assurance but also create new economic opportunities for Indiana’s growing tech and manufacturing sector. With the support of Indiana-based manufacturers and state economic programs, CMT has established a more resilient, efficient, and collaborative manufacturing process.

Navigating International Challenges While Strengthening Supply Chains

Copper Mountain Technologies’ reshoring efforts were also partly a result of global events that directly impacted its operations. Before 2022, CMT worked with an engineering team and a contract manufacturer in Russia. However, following Russia’s invasion of Ukraine, the company made an immediate decision to relocate both its engineering and production operations.

As part of this transition, it established CMT Europe in Paphos, Cyprus, which now houses an R&D office and service center. This has ensured localized support for European, Middle Eastern, and Asia-Pacific customers, making service and repairs more accessible. The company also rebuilt its supply chain, working with manufacturing partners in the U.S., Israel, South Korea, and Cyprus to ensure consistent production.

State Support Paves the Way for Expansion and Job Creation

Copper Mountain Technologies’ decision to bring its manufacturing to Indiana has been backed by state economic development programs that help companies grow, hire more workers, and modernize their operations. These programs are designed to support manufacturers that want to improve efficiency, adopt the latest technology, and expand their workforce.

In 2023, Copper Mountain Technologies was awarded a Manufacturing Readiness Grant from the Indiana Economic Development Corporation (IEDC), with funding provided by Conexus Indiana. This grant helps Indiana manufacturers upgrade their technology and improve production capabilities. Thanks to this support, CMT has been able to refine its assembly process, introduce new production methods, and better meet customer demand.

The company has also been approved for the IEDC’s Economic Development for a Growing Economy (EDGE) Program. This initiative provides tax incentives to businesses that create new jobs. The program offers flexibility in workforce planning, allowing the company to scale efficiently without compromising performance or customer support.

About Copper Mountain Technologies:

Copper Mountain Technologies was founded on the idea that RF test and measurement solutions should be accessible, adaptable, and affordable. The company revolutionized vector network analyzers (VNAs) by developing USB-based models that offer lab-grade accuracy with enhanced flexibility and cost efficiency.

Headquartered in Indianapolis, Indiana, CMT operates an R&D office and service center in Cyprus and maintains sales offices in Singapore, London, and Miami. Its technology serves engineers in nearly 100 countries across industries such as telecommunications, aerospace, defense, and scientific research.
